(Sports Network) - The Cleveland Cavaliers will try to stop a three-game losing streak tonight, when they welcome the Philadelphia 76ers to Quicken Loans Arena.
Cleveland has dropped three straight for the first time since a six-game slide from November 28 - December 8 this season. It suffered an 85-71 setback to the rival Detroit Pistons on Saturday at The Palace of Auburn Hills, as LeBron James scored only 13 points on 4-of-17 shooting. Cleveland clinched a playoff berth despite the loss thanks to a New Jersey setback versus Phoenix.
Zydrunas Ilgauskas and Devin Brown each ended with 11 points for the Cavs, who sit fourth in the Eastern Conference standings -- just 1 1/2 games ahead of Washington. Joe Smith tallied 10 points for the Cavs.
The Cavaliers have won nine of 10 home games and own a 24-11 record as the host in 2007-08. In injury news for Cleveland, center Ben Wallace (back) is doubtful for Sunday's game, while guard Delonte West (ankle) is questionable.
Meanwhile, Philadelphia will open a three-game road trip tonight against the Cavs, Nets and Hawks, and is 16-20 away from the Wachovia Center this season. It is 6-1 in its last seven contests as the guest.
The Sixers had a three-game winning streak come to an end with Friday's 107-93 home loss to the Phoenix Suns, as Andre Miller tallied 16 points and 10 assists in a losing effort. Philly fell to seventh place in the Eastern Conference standings, just a half game behind Toronto for the sixth spot.
Louis Williams ended with 15 points and Andre Iguodala had 13 in the loss, only Philadelphia's third this month (11-3).
The 76ers posted a 92-86 victory over Cleveland on December 15 at Quicken Loans Arena, snapping a two-game slide in the series. The Cavaliers have won four of the last six matchups with the Sixers.
Philadelphia has won two in a row on the road in this series.
